CSKA sign Wernbloom from Alkmaar

Sweden midfielder Pontus Wernbloom has joined PFC CSKA Moskva from AZ Alkmaar on a four-and-a-half-year deal, becoming the Russian side's second January buy after Ahmed Musa.

PFC CSKA Moskva have signed midfielder Pontus Wernbloom from AZ Alkmaar on a four-and-a-half-year contract.

Wernbloom, 25, is the UEFA Champions League contenders' second January recruit after forward Ahmed Musa arrived from Alkmaar's Eredivisie rivals VVV Venlo earlier this week. The Swedish international has already joined up with his new team-mates at their Spanish training base in Campoamor.

Having begun his career at IFK Göteborg, Wernbloom moved to then champions AZ in summer 2009 and leaves them at the Eredivisie summit, having also helped the Dutch club progress through the UEFA Europa League group stage unbeaten. He made his senior Sweden debut in January 2007 and was a regular squad member in their successful UEFA EURO 2012 qualifying campaign.

CSKA, second in the extended Russian Premier-Liga – six points behind FC Zenit St Petersburg at the winter break – face Real Madrid CF in the UEFA Champions League round of 16, staging the first leg on 21 February before a trip to Spain on 14 March.
